Renewal of Registration under the Company Certification Scheme (VAT, IEPS and AEO)

Companies that hold registration under the Company Certification Scheme, in the VAT, IEPS and/or Authorized Economic Operator (AEO) modalities, are hereby informed that they must submit their renewal application within the deadlines established by the authority.

In accordance with Procedure Sheet 61/LA and the provisions of Rule 7.2.3 of the General Rules of Foreign Trade, the renewal must be requested within the 30 business days prior to the expiration of the registration and submitted through the Single Window (VUCEM).

Once the application has been filed, the registration will be considered renewed as of the business day following the acknowledgment of receipt, provided that the company is not subject to a cancellation procedure, in accordance with Rules 7.2.4 and 7.2.5 of the General Rules of Foreign Trade currently in force.

It is important to note that during the month of December, the tax authority observes non-business days due to its vacation period, which runs from December 18, 2025, to January 2, 2026. Therefore, it is recommended to submit the application in advance in order to avoid delays or issues.
